Gonzaga University - Student Life

Student Life

Gonzaga Student Body Association ("GSBA"), is in charge of the clubs and activities on campus. Elections for offices such as President, Vice President, and Senator take place annually during the fall.

In addition, the university requires all Freshman and Sophomore students reside on campus.

The Knights and Setons are Gonzaga’s sophomore service clubs that are made up of 60 sophomores (30 men make up the Knights, and 30 women make up the Setons). Every year, the Knights and Setons raise money for a charity of their choice, their most successful fund raiser being the charity ball held every fall. They do charity work all over the university and are involved in events such as New Student Orientation and Graduation.
